M Cash Integrated Net Profit Sped Nearly 12 Times in First Half-2018

INDUSTRY.co.id - Jakarta - PT M Cash Integration Tbk (MCAS) recorded a net profit of Rp45.1 billion in the first half of 2018, or jumped 11.7 times compared to the actual net profit per June 2017 of Rp3.8 billion.

According to the management's written report on Friday (27/07/2018), the surge was supported by strong revenue growth of 287.5% to Rp1.80 trillion in the first half of 2018 compared to the same period in 2017 of Rp465 billion.

Meanwhile, the total asset value of the company as of June 30, 2018 was recorded at Rp727 billion or 27.9% higher than the total asset up to June 20, 2017 of Rp568 billion. Rp109 billion of the asset's value is in the form of cash money.

The company is currently expanding its distribution network aggressively and executing its investment strategy. It can be seen from the growth of the number of kiosks doubled to 1,700 kiosks by June 2018 compared to the end of December 2017 as many as 809 kiosks.

Meanwhile, digital agents are increasing from 27,000 agents by the end of 2017 to as many as 36,000 agents by 30 June 2018. The average number of transactions in June 2018 was 340,000 transactions per day compared to March 2018 of 202,000 transactions per day. The highest average transaction of the company reached 331,000 transactions per day.

This year, the company will change its business strategy through a more comprehensive approach. The Company enlarges its distribution network and initiates a synergistic strategic approach with all business portfolios within a distribution ecosystem currently under development. (Abraham Sihombing)
